Mining Incidents
Fatality · MSHA Record #219840050004

Electrician

December 22, 1983 at 9:10 AM
Viburnum #28 Mine/Mill · Underground · Metal/Non-Metal
Iron County, MO
Classification ELECTRICAL
Type Contact with electrical current
Investigator narrative
WHILE MAKING HOIST REPAIRS MAIN POWER CONTACTOR WAS OPENED AND ROLLED OUT ON TO FLOOR TO CHANGE COIL APPARENTLY OPERATING LINKAGE HAD STUCK NOT ALLOWING MECHANISM TO OPEN ALL THE WAY TO THE LATCHED POSITION AND WHEN CONTACTOR WAS PUSHED BACK IN IT OPERATED THE SWITCH LINKAGE IN REVERSE PULLING CONTACTOR IN TO HOT BUSS CAUSING FATALITY
